Built around a dreadnought body, the right-handed CD-60S V2 combines a solid spruce top with laminated mahogany back and sides. Its acoustic response is balanced and full, with the projection needed for chord work and picked melodies. The slim mahogany neck and rolled fretboard edges are designed to make longer fretting sessions more comfortable. The pack also brings together a gig bag, strap, picks, extra strings, and three months of Fender Play access for getting started.
